Meeting notes — Spares run to Grevlin Ridge Station (excerpt). Agreed: the pump seals, two control relays, and the backup valve kit ship Wednesday on the Carrowby Freight run. Coordinator to assign a driver with cold-weather training; road past Myle Fork is gravel after the junction. Site contact will meet the vehicle at the gate — no unloading without them present. Because the relays are controlled inventory, the gate contact will release them only after the driver states this phrase:

courier memo of yahif-faweg: the quenael tamius courier leaves the prawyn jorix kaswyn istox silmir brieth zormir fenvan ledger at gate 3145 under passcode 231062

**Action Item 7:** The Brindlehop session-token refresh bug caused clients to retry with stale tokens for up to 40 minutes after the auth node restarted. On-call should add an alert on refresh-failure rate above 2% and verify the new token-rotation grace window in staging by Friday. Mitigation steps, rollback instructions, and the alert definition are documented on the page below.

dashboard of yaguf-hahig = https://grafana.urlaqworks.test/secrets

Ticket: Batch email digests on Mintgrove fire twice when a tenant's schedule crosses midnight in a non-UTC zone. Root cause: scheduler normalizes to UTC after dedupe, not before. Fix: normalize in the enqueue step. Watch for tenants with DST transitions — add regression cases. Verified on staging; the passing run's trace token is included below for future reference.

build token for kagaf-hahof: htk14_9d3d4d26d7d8de